Raiders Finish Third at GPAC Championships

Apr 24, 2009

The Northwestern College women's golf team finished third after the fourth and final round of the GPAC Championship. The final round was hosted by Northwestern and held at the Landsmeer Golf Club in Orange City.

The Raiders shot a 352 in the final round and placed second on the day but were unable to overtake GPAC runner-up USF. Northwestern finished the four rounds with a team score of 1,448, 20 shots in back of second place USF (1,428). Dakota Wesleyan, who led by 55 strokes heading into the final round, added to its lead with a first place finish and a score of 341 on the final day. The Tigers totaled a team score of 1,359. USF placed third in the fourth round with a 355. Both Dakota Wesleyan and USF will advance to play in the NAIA Women's Golf National Championships in May which will be played in Rapid City, South Dakota, at the Meadowbrook Golf Course.

Hastings College held off Briar Cliff to finish in fourth place with a cumulative team score of 1,475. The Chargers were one shot back and placed fifth with a 1,476.

Individually, Danielle Bellet of Dakota Wesleyan earned medalist honors in the fourth round with an 83 (41/42) and won the overall GPAC Championship by seven strokes over teammate Kelli Basely. Basely tied for second on the day with an 85 and finished the overall championship with a 333. Jenny Andrew of Hastings placed third overall with a 339 after she tied for second place in the fourth round with an 85. Kate Becker (Midland Lutheran) and Heather Love (Dakota Wesleyan) round out the top five with a 343 and 344, respectively. The top ten individuals in the four conference meets will receive medals and be designated as all-conference. To qualify for these ten spots the individual must play in all four meets.

Northwestern was led by Carrie Spree and Rachelle Pedersen who tied for second today with an 85. Andria Hinz and Kelsey Shiflett tied for 16th place with a 91 and Maggie Achterhof tied for 24th with a 94.  Overall, Spree just missed out on the 10th spot by two strokes and finished 11th with a 359. Achterhof ended tied for 16th with a 367. Shiflett (T20) and Pedersen (26th) also placed for NWC. Hinz totaled a 181 in the final two rounds.
